[GB] 3/31/19 Live Playtest

Postby Eliahad » Sun Mar 31, 2019 11:49 pm

Players: Dante, Paul, David
Gods: Poseidon, Hermes, Hera
Rounds: 12
Final Score: 1, 2, 1
Time: Teaching 35 - 45 mintues; Playing, about 2 hours.

Today's playtest was with 2 new to the game players. They both have experience with games (one is an 8th grader, one is his dad), up to and including tabletop RPG, but not necessarily Eurogame experience. In fact, I'm pretty sure they haven't played a Euro. Which only matters as to the experiences they are used to in games.

They had a blast, and quickly and unprompted offered as many future playtests as we need. They are both incredibly thoughtful and offered good advice on little changes. The game experience (except for the length of game) was spot on. Epic moments happened. Clever moments happened (including an artful play from Dante that was the first point of the game. Calypso broke open, tossed the ball to some dolphins who nosed it into the goal. At which point everyone was hooked.)

Positives:

Smaller Deck = more likely those epic moments happen. Switching to 24 cards was the right choice.

New Hera and Poseidon are huge steps in the right direction. Hera has some more tweaks, Poseidon seemed good.

EVERYONE had at least one moment of..."Okay, here's what I'm going to do."

Dante, being a very patient person, would wait patiently for his turn..and then as Paul neared the end of his turn would start saying, "Are you finished? Are you finished? Did you draw a card?" and THEN excitedly execute the plan he had worked out. It was amazing.

The new rules are great. I just need to learn how to explain them better.

Negatives:

Game length. Hoo boy, this is an issue. As you learn the cards, you'll be able to see your possibilities more quickly, but as it stands now, the text and the gronking of cards slows the game down. The GAME is good, I might say 'Very Good' even, but the upscale of time on the first game is immense. I have ideas on a 'beginners' game, but it doesn't make me feel that great about it...because the GAME is in the interactions of the more complicated cards. This is a thing we need to think on, and make sure we're okay with and/or find solutions for.

Teaching is hard, except we need new audiences to teach on. I really should find some time to actually practice a script on my own so it feels comfortable and natural. I'm not there yet, and I get distracted by questions. I can be good at this, I just need to work on it.

TWEAKS:

DIVE: Can you choose to dive off of terrain if someone else wants to move you on the terrain?
DIVE: If you dive, does hex cost apply? (If yes, make sure that's on the hero boards.)
DIVE was still one of the more complicated things. I was going off of my understanding of the new rule. I need to read Mike's rule changes.

From Paul: REST: Gain 2 AP (instead of REGAIN 2 AP, Regain implies you've spent something. But really, you're just gaining it. I think this is a word we can use to replace 'restore, regain, and all the other words we have for getting AP back. It would simplify that part immensely.)

Lots of duplicate card titles. Probably my fault.

Cards that need tweaking and/or have typos: HM-GF-08, HR-GF-07, PS-MR-05 (up to 3), HR-MR-03 (add "and terrain.), HR-MR-03 is one of 2 cards named Waterspout, Poseidon has the other. Hermes and Poseidon both have 'Clear Paths." Poseidon "Clear Path" is not clear as to what terrain it is intended to affect.

tl;dr - It was a great game, good experience. Too long.

Addendum to the Dive rule:

Dive is a reaction, and can only be taken on someone else's turn. It costs 2 AP + hex cost of the hex you dive into.

You may dive if terrain moves into your hex, or if terrain in the hex you are on begins to move.

When you dive, move your hero to any adjacent unoccupied hex that did not contain the moving terrain token that turn. This means if the terrain moved through multiple hexes to get to you, you may not move into any of those hexes.
